1. Image Quality
One of the most important features of any sonography machine is its image quality. High-resolution images provide clear and detailed views of the animal’s internal structures, which are crucial for accurate diagnosis. When evaluating image quality, consider the following:
- Resolution: The machine should offer high-resolution images that can distinguish even small abnormalities. A resolution of at least 1280 x 1024 pixels is generally recommended for high-quality imaging.
- Depth Penetration: For larger animals like cows, 말, and camels, the ultrasound machine should have the capability to penetrate deeper into the body to provide detailed images of organs such as the liver, kidneys, and reproductive systems.
- Contrast Resolution: The ability to differentiate between structures of similar density is critical. A good contrast resolution will help the veterinarian distinguish between healthy and abnormal tissues.

4. Durability and Build Quality
Veterinary sonography machines are often used in challenging environments, whether on a farm, in a zoo, or in an equine clinic. The machine must be durable enough to withstand various conditions, such as being bumped, dropped, or exposed to environmental factors like dust, moisture, or heat.
- Water-Resistant and Shock-Proof: Choose a machine with a robust build and water-resistant features. A shock-proof design ensures that the device can withstand accidental drops or bumps during transport or while in use.
- Protective Covers for Transducers: The transducers (the part of the machine that emits and receives sound waves) should have durable covers that protect them from damage during use and storage.
5. Compatibility with Different Animal Species
Veterinary sonography machines should be versatile enough to be used with various animal species. Different animals require different probe types and imaging techniques, and the machine should be adaptable to these needs.
- Multiple Probe Options: Look for a machine that offers a range of probe types for different species, such as convex probes for large animals like cows and horses, linear probes for small animals like dogs and cats, and phased array probes for deep imaging.
- Tailored Settings for Species: Some sonography machines come with pre-set modes or settings that are optimized for specific species. 예를 들어, settings for equine ultrasound will differ from those used for small animal diagnostics.
6. Advanced Imaging Features
Advanced imaging features can significantly improve the quality of the images and provide additional diagnostic tools to the veterinarian. Some of these advanced features include:
- Doppler Imaging: Doppler ultrasound allows veterinarians to visualize blood flow in vessels, which is essential for detecting heart disease, 종양, or any other conditions related to blood circulation.
- Elastography: This technique helps assess tissue stiffness, which can be important in diagnosing liver fibrosis or tumors.
